Search Results:Recreational Gulf Red Snapper and South Region Spotted Seatrout Seasons Close November 1Summary: The recreational harvest seasons for red snapper in the Gulf of Mexico and spotted seatrout in the South Region will close on November 1. These closures occur each year to help rebuild overfished red snapper stocks in the Gulf and maintain the abundance of spotted seatrout in Florida waters.

BASS Announces Schedule for 2009 Bassmaster Opens; New Northern Division Highlights Diverse ScheduleSummary:
The 2009 Bassmaster Opens, comprised of three qualifying series in a Southern, Central and revamped Northern division, each with three events, will visit diverse and productive fisheries for a total of nine events in Florida, Alabama, South Carolina, Maryland, New York, Ohio, Louisiana and Texas, BASS announced today. Yellowstone Fires Sparked Elk Foundation Work in 24 StatesSummary:
This year marks the 20th anniversary of the great Yellowstone fires.
